She studied piano at the Conservatoire à rayonnement régional de Boulogne-Billancourt, then the cello, and the double bass with Jean-François Jenny-Clark.
She began her career as a variety accompanist (CharlÉlie Couture, Jeanne Balibar), and world music (Fania).
She joined the Magic Malik Orchestra in 2000, and is also part of the group Las Ondas Marteles with Sébastien Martel. She founded her group, Caroline, in 2001, alongside Franck Vaillant, Gilles Coronado and Olivier Py. In 2005 and 2006, she starred in Steve Coleman's band.
She also composed film scores, The Eil of the Other and Man of Crowds, by filmmaker John Lvoff, and worked as an arranger for Paul Ouazan's musical broadcasts on Arte.
In 2022, she participated in the National Jazz Orchestra for the "Ex Machina" program, composed by Steve Lehman and Frédéric Maurin.
